No, the counselling and seat allotment is done purely on the basis of JEE Mains and through the JoSAA portal. Madhya Pradesh does have it's exam called MPPET which after a time was stopped and admissions were continued on AIEEE and then JEE Mains.

Admission to B.Pharma courses are done through online counseling conducted by Department of Technical Education, Madhya Pradesh, Bhopal. For more please visit https://dte.mponline.gov.in or http://www.dtempcounselling.org.
